Ataxia UK

For over 50 years Ataxia UK has been the leading charity for people with ataxia, their families and carers. Ataxia is the name given to a group of life-limiting, neurological disorders that affect balance, coordination, and speech.

Ataxia

There are many different types of ataxia that can affect people in different ways. Anyone of any age can get ataxia, but certain types are more common in certain age groups. For example, people with Friedreich’s ataxia are usually diagnosed in childhood or adolescence. There are at least 10,000 adults and around 500 children in the UK with a progressive ataxia. Some forms of ataxia are treatable, but in most cases there is still no cure. We are supporting research and putting in lots of effort to get treatments or cures for the ataxias whilst supporting people affected by ataxia until a cure is found.
